School Overview
Dartmouth Elementary School, located in Aurora, Colorado, serves a diverse community within the Aurora Public Schools district. The school is committed to fostering an inclusive learning environment that emphasizes academic growth, social-emotional development, and the cultivation of critical thinking skills. By integrating modern instructional strategies with a supportive school culture, Dartmouth aims to prepare its students to succeed as lifelong learners and responsible citizens in an increasingly globalized world.
The school places a strong emphasis on community engagement and parental involvement, recognizing that a collaborative partnership between home and school is essential for student achievement. With a focus on equity and high expectations for every child, Dartmouth provides a variety of programs and resources designed to meet the unique needs of its student body. Whether through classroom instruction or extracurricular opportunities, the school strives to create a welcoming atmosphere where students feel empowered to reach their full potential.
